Ticket: Config drift in Ormwright legacy ORM refactor

Welcome aboard. While refactoring the Ormwright data layer for Pellicle Systems, we found the staging pool settings no longer match what's in version control. Someone hand-edited connection limits months ago. Please reconcile carefully — downstream batch jobs depend on current behavior. For reference, staging is actually running with these values:

config for yajep-tafof:
[rusath]
team = julmir
access_code = ac_fe37fd
host = rusath.novactech.test
port = 8000
owner = pelmir.weneth
peer = oliwyn.olvarqdyn.internal

Subject: Partitioning cut-over complete

Hi, welcome aboard — quick summary of last weekend's work before you dig in. We migrated the events table in Quarrystone from a single monolithic table to monthly partitions. Old rows were backfilled into partitions through a rolling copy; writes now route by event month automatically. Retention drops partitions older than 18 months. Queries must include the month column to get partition pruning. The partition manager runs with the following configuration.

settings of bafof-fajog:
[aldix]
port = 9300
region = north-3
host = aldix.kelvilabs.example
team = istath
timeout_ms = 1500
retries = 8

// Fixture: sharded user-profile store for the Quillbase migration tests.
// Profiles are hashed by account UUID across eight virtual shards; the
// rebalancer fixture simulates a shard split mid-write. Keep seed data
// deterministic or the assertion on shard boundaries will flake.
// The mock Quillbase gateway validates requests against the bearer token below.

login token, bagug-kafop: eyJhbGciOiJIUzI1NiIsInR5cCI6IkpXVCJ9.eyJzdWIiOiIcMLov2In0.Z5RLDIfp

Welcome to the Stormline fan-out service. When the Galehaven feed publishes a weather alert, Stormline expands it into per-subscriber messages across push, SMS-bridge, and webhook channels. Ordering is guaranteed per region but not globally; dedupe keys are derived from alert serial plus channel. Please read the backpressure notes before touching the queue depths — past incidents came from careless retuning. Emergency reprocessing requires unlocking the replay vault, and for that you must enter the recovery passphrase below.

unlock words, yawig-kagef: gordor-holvan-ulaael-pramir-ulaiel-tamdor